#9bdf29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bdf29 is composed of 60.8% red, 87.5%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 82.4 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 51.8%. #9bdf29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#37bf00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#9bdf29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050801 is the darkest color, while #fbf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9bdf29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858a7e is the less saturated color, while #a2fb0d is the most saturated one.
